Brian Salomon2ee084e2016-12-16 18:59:19 -050028/**
Jim Van Verth106b5c42017-09-26 12:45:29 -040029 * This class manages one or more atlas textures on behalf of GrDrawOps. The draw ops that use the
30 * atlas perform texture uploads when preparing their draws during flush. The class provides
31 * facilities for using GrDrawOpUploadToken to detect data hazards. Op's uploads are performed in
Brian Salomon29b60c92017-10-31 14:42:10 -040032 * "ASAP" mode until it is impossible to add data without overwriting texels read by draws that
Jim Van Verth106b5c42017-09-26 12:45:29 -040033 * have not yet executed on the gpu. At that point, the atlas will attempt to allocate a new
34 * atlas texture (or "page") of the same size, up to a maximum number of textures, and upload
35 * to that texture. If that's not possible, the uploads are performed "inline" between draws. If a
36 * single draw would use enough subimage space to overflow the atlas texture then the atlas will
37 * fail to add a subimage. This gives the op the chance to end the draw and begin a new one.
38 * Additional uploads will then succeed in inline mode.
39 *
40 * When the atlas has multiple pages, new uploads are prioritized to the lower index pages, i.e.,
41 * it will try to upload to page 0 before page 1 or 2. To keep the atlas from continually using
42 * excess space, periodic garbage collection is needed to shift data from the higher index pages to
43 * the lower ones, and then eventually remove any pages that are no longer in use. "In use" is
44 * determined by using the GrDrawUploadToken system: After a flush each subarea of the page
45 * is checked to see whether it was used in that flush; if it is not, a counter is incremented.
46 * Once that counter reaches a threshold that subarea is considered to be no longer in use.
47 *
48 * Garbage collection is initiated by the GrDrawOpAtlas's client via the compact() method. One
49 * solution is to make the client a subclass of GrOnFlushCallbackObject, register it with the
50 * GrContext via addOnFlushCallbackObject(), and the client's postFlush() method calls compact()
51 * and passes in the given GrDrawUploadToken.
Brian Salomon2ee084e2016-12-16 18:59:19 -050052 */

Brian Salomon2ee084e2016-12-16 18:59:19 -0500320 /**
321 * The backing GrTexture for a GrDrawOpAtlas is broken into a spatial grid of Plots. The Plots
322 * keep track of subimage placement via their GrRectanizer. A Plot manages the lifetime of its
323 * data using two tokens, a last use token and a last upload token. Once a Plot is "full" (i.e.
324 * there is no room for the new subimage according to the GrRectanizer), it can no longer be
325 * used unless the last use of the Plot has already been flushed through to the gpu.
326 */

Brian Salomon2ee084e2016-12-16 18:59:19 -0500348 /**
349 * To manage the lifetime of a plot, we use two tokens. We use the last upload token to
350 * know when we can 'piggy back' uploads, i.e. if the last upload hasn't been flushed to
351 * the gpu, we don't need to issue a new upload even if we update the cpu backing store. We
352 * use lastUse to determine when we can evict a plot from the cache, i.e. if the last use
353 * has already flushed through the gpu then we can reuse the plot.
354 */
